Flashcards in a book for the Psychiatry shelf exam and the USMLE Step 2 CK--written by students, for students
Deja Review: Psychiatry boils down your course work to just the critical concepts. Drawn from the perspectives of top students fresh from their shelf exams and the USMLE Step 2 CK, this unbeatable guide features a quick-read Q&A format--one that helps you efficiently plow through a large amount of information. It also allows you to zero-in on only correct answers to promote memory retention and maximize your study time.
